Summit Hotel Properties  (NYSE:INNpCCL.PFD) Revenue per Available Room (USD) Calculation

Revenue per Available Room (USD) is calculated as

Revenue per Available Room (USD)=Average Daily Rate (USD) * Average Occupancy Rate %
=Total Room Revenue / Number of Available Rooms

Summit Hotel Properties  (NYSE:INNpCCL.PFD) Revenue per Available Room (USD) Explanation

Revenue per Available Room (USD) is a metric used in the hospitality industry to measure hotel performance, calcualted by multiplying Average Daily Rate (USD) by Average Occupancy Rate %. Thus, an increase in a property's RevPAR means that its average room rate or its occupancy rate is improving. However, it does not necessarily mean greater profits as it fails to consider the size of a hotel.

Summit Hotel Properties Inc is a U.S.-based hotel investment company focusing on select-service hotels in the upscale and upper-midscale properties in the U.S. Substantially all of Summit's assets are held and operated by its Operating Partnership, Summit Hotel OP, LP, in which the company holds general and limited partnership interests. The firm has one segment in activities related to investing in real estate. Summit's revenue streams include Room and Other hotel operations revenue. Room comprises the majority of total revenues. The firm's hotels are located in various markets, such as corporate offices, retail centers, airports, state capitols, convention centers, and leisure attractions. Summit's hotels operate under brands, including Marriott, Hilton, Hyatt, and Holiday Inn.
